LBC 34xx/12 Horn Loudspeakers
Bosch high-efficiency horn loudspeakers provide excellent speech reproduction and sound distribution for a wide scope of outdoor applications. They are ideal for sports grounds, parks, exhibitions, factories and swimming pools.
All four models are for direct connection to a 100 V line output and are finished in light grey (RAL 7035). The horns are water and dust protected.
The horn loudspeakers include a 100 V transformer with taps on the primary winding to allow different power settings. Nominal full-power, half-power or quarterpower radiation (i.e. in 3 dB steps) can easily be selected by connecting the amplifier output to the appropriate tap. A two meter long four-core cable is fitted to the horns. Each core is a different color, and is connected to one of the primary taps on the transformer.
The horn loudspeakers are supplied complete with sturdy adjustable mounting brackets, allowing the sound beam to be accurately directed.

The LBC 3481/12 is a circular horn loudspeaker with 15 W (max power) which is made from ABS
The LBC 3491/12 is a rectangular model with 15 W (max power) and is made from ABS.
The 30 W (max power) LBC 3492/12 is a circular loudspeaker with a large horn measuring 354mm in diameter. It is made from a combination of aluminum with ABS for optimum strength and low weight. The edge of the horn is covered with a PVC profile for protection against impact damage.
The 45 W (max power) LBC 3493/12 is a circular loudspeaker with a large horn measuring 400mm in diameter. It is made from a combination of aluminum with ABS for optimum strength and low weight. The edge of the horn is covered with PVC for protection against impact damage.
All Bosch loudspeakers are designed to withstand operating at their rated power for 100 hours in accordance with IEC 268-5 Power Handling Capacity (PHC) standards. Bosch has also developed the Simulated Acoustical Feedback Exposure (SAFE) test to demonstrate that they can withstand two times their
